下列定义的css中,哪个权重是最低的
时间: 2024-04-17 09:29:43 浏览: 7
在CSS中,以下是按从高到低排序的选择器权重(优先级):
1. !important:具有最高优先级,会覆盖其他所有规则。
2. 内联样式(Inline styles):直接在HTML元素上使用style属性指定的样式,优先级高于其他选择器。
3. ID选择器(#id):通过元素的id属性选择元素,优先级较高。
4. 类选择器(.class)和属性选择器([attribute]):通过类名或属性选择元素,优先级较低于ID选择器。
5. 伪类选择器(:pseudo-class)和伪元素选择器(::pseudo-element):通过特定状态或位置选择元素,优先级较低。
6. 元素选择器(element)和伪元素选择器(::before、::after等):通过元素类型或伪元素选择元素,优先级最低。
综上所述,元素选择器和伪元素选择器的权重是最低的。
相关问题
css规则定义对话框中文
CSS规则定义对话框是一个用于编辑CSS样式规则的工具,可以通过该工具来设置网页的字体、颜色、大小、边框等样式。在使用CSS规则定义对话框时,需要按照一定的规则来定义样式。
首先,要选择要修改的元素,可以选中一个已存在的选择器,或者创建一个新选择器。然后,在“样式”区域中,可以设置该元素的各种样式属性,例如“字体”、“颜色”等。在设置属性时,需要注意按照正确的格式来输入值,值可以是像素、百分比、颜色值等单位。同时,还可以设置元素的盒模型属性,如“边框”、“外边距”等。最后,点击“确定”按钮即可完成CSS规则的定义。
总的来说,CSS规则定义对话框是一个方便快捷的工具,但是在使用时需要注意掌握CSS的基本知识及相应的语法规则,才能更好地利用该工具编写出高质量的网页样式。
CSS中定义样式名称 样式 格式
为了定义CSS样式名称和样式格式,我们需要采用以下语法:
样式名称 {
样式属性1: 属性值1;
样式属性2: 属性值2;
样式属性3: 属性值3;
...
}
其中,样式名称指的是我们要定义样式的元素名称或者类名称,以及其它选择器;样式属性和属性值则是我们要针对该元素或类定义的样式信息。例如:
div {
background-color: black;
color: white;
}
以上 CSS 样式代码表示,我们想设置所有 div 元素的背景为黑色,字体颜色为白色。类似地,我们也可以通过类名称来定义样式:
.my-class {
font-size: 16px;
font-weight: bold;
}
以上 CSS 样式代码表示,我们定义一个名称为 my-class 的类,设置其字体大小为 16px,字体加粗。然后,我们可以在 HTML 中使用该类:
<div class="my-class">这里是一个带有样式的 DIV 元素。</div>